Jumping Weevil vs Montane Colilargo
Orchestes testaceus compared with Microryzomys minutus
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Jumping Weevil | Montane Colilargo |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(Arthropods)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Insecta (Insects)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Coleoptera (Beetles)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Curculionidae | Cricetidae |
| Genus | Orchestes | Microryzomys |
| Species | Orchestes testaceus | Microryzomys minutus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Jumping Weevil and Montane Colilargo share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
